Sql server Azure-未找到网络路径

Sql server Azure-未找到网络路径,sql-server,azure,networking,Sql Server,Azure,Networking,我有4个Azure虚拟机,它们是同一资源组和虚拟网络的一部分。其中3个运行SQL Server,1个配置为域控制器。3个SQL VM正在从DC获取DNS 虚拟机可以登录到域并在网络上看到彼此。但是,当我尝试在虚拟网络中使用connect to SQL实例时,我收到一个“网络路径未找到”错误 我已经重命名了实例,甚至尝试删除和重新安装它们。因此,我确信这是一个网络问题,而不是SQL Server问题。我也不能通过IP地址连接,所以它似乎不是DNS 这些实例都是默认实例,并在1433上连接,虚拟机都

我有4个Azure虚拟机,它们是同一资源组和虚拟网络的一部分。其中3个运行SQL Server,1个配置为域控制器。3个SQL VM正在从DC获取DNS

虚拟机可以登录到域并在网络上看到彼此。但是,当我尝试在虚拟网络中使用connect to SQL实例时,我收到一个“网络路径未找到”错误

我已经重命名了实例,甚至尝试删除和重新安装它们。因此,我确信这是一个网络问题,而不是SQL Server问题。我也不能通过IP地址连接,所以它似乎不是DNS


这些实例都是默认实例,并在1433上连接,虚拟机都有TCP 1433端点,Windows防火墙已关闭。

我认为您还需要从Azure服务启用端口

这些实例都是默认实例,并连接到 虚拟机都有TCP 1433端点,Windows防火墙关闭

确保所有计算机中的两个端口都已打开14331434

还要记住,禁用windows防火墙只是暂时的,一旦连接测试通过,就应该重新启用它

注意根据您的连接/服务类型,您还应打开:

  • 1433:/TCP/UDP
  • 80:用于通过HTTP/TCP进行同步
  • 443:在HTTPS端点/TCP上运行的SQL Server默认实例
  • 4022:ServiceBroker/TCP
  • 135:Transact-SQL调试器/TCP
  • 7022:事实数据库镜像/TCP
  • 2383:SQL Server分析服务
  • 2382:到Analysis Services的命名实例的连接请求

正如我在问题中提到的,我已经创建了端点。这就是你的意思吗?尝试远程登录iPhone,端口号无法打开端口1433上的主机连接:连接失败。我应该说,在这些服务器/实例加入domainWich方法连接到sql实例之前,它们可以完美地通信?什么是连接字符串?您尝试过通过SQL控制台客户端连接吗?我尝试过通过SSMS、SQLCMD和无法telnet连接到portDC不在PremiseHi上,对不起,1434是一个输入错误。1433上连接的默认实例。1434 UDP不是必需的。是的,Win F/W是暂时的。我知道我需要什么端口,谢谢。我只是需要一些网络方面的帮助,为什么我不能通过虚拟网络连接到端口,在配置域之后,你是否将域DNS添加到Azure VNET DNS?